When meeting an individual, be it for the initially time ever or just the initially time that day, it is popular to shake hands — but in Indonesia this is no knuckle-crusher, just a light touching of the palms, generally followed by bringing your hand to your chest. Meetings normally start out and finish with everybody shaking hands with everyone. However, do not attempt to shake hands with a Muslim lady unless she offers her hand 1st. It is respectful to bend slightly when greeting someone older or in a position of authority. Polite forms of address for folks you do not know are Bapak (“Father”) for guys and Ibu (“Mother”) for women.

This consortium is known as the Inter-Governmental Group on Indonesia and includes the United States, Canada, Australia, New Zealand, Japan, Britain and a number of West-European nations. Its annual meetings are held in Amsterdam beneath the chairmanship of the Netherlands. At present, the IGGI has been replaced by the Consultative Group for Indonesia consisting of the former members of IGGI and five new creditors. President Soekarno had to his credit the holding of the Asian-African Conference in Bandung, West Java, from April 18 to 24, 1955. The initiative was taken by Indonesia, India, Pakistan, Myanmar and Ceylon . The conference was attended by delegates from 24 Asian and African countries.

Examples include things like war dances, a dance of witch physicians, and a dance to call for rain or any agricultural rituals such as Hudoq. Indonesian dances derive their influences from the archipelago’s prehistoric and tribal, Hindu-Buddhist, and Islamic periods. Lately, modern day dances and urban teen dances have gained recognition due to the influence of Western culture and these of Japan and South Korea to some extent. However, a variety of regular dances, which includes those of Java, Bali and Dayak, remain a living and dynamic tradition. As with the arts, Indonesian architecture has absorbed foreign influences that have brought cultural changes and profound effects on creating styles and strategies. The most dominant has traditionally been Indian nevertheless, Chinese, Arab, and European influences have also been substantial.

Fragments from the outer skin of the Indo-Australian Plate—chunks of sedimentary rock initially laid down under sea level—were scraped off at the subduction zone and thrown up along the southern edge of the Sunda Plate like flotsam. These fragments would eventually kind the islands of Timor, Sabu and Sumba, the high limestone peninsula that hangs at the southern tip of Bali, and the banks of karst that stretch through southern Java.
